DescriptionCVE.org

A DLL hijacking vulnerability within the AMD Ryzen Master installation could allow a local user-privileged attacker to escalate privileges, potentially resulting in arbitrary code execution.

AnalysisAI

DLL hijacking during the AMD Ryzen Master installation process allows a local low-privileged attacker to escalate privileges and execute arbitrary code on Windows systems running affected versions. The flaw, rooted in an uncontrolled DLL search path (CWE-427), affects AMD Ryzen Master up to 3.0.0.4199, Ryzen Master SDK up to 3.0.1.4732, and a legacy branch for Ryzen 3000 Series processors up to 2.14.3.5040. No public exploit code has been identified at time of analysis, and this vulnerability is not listed in the CISA KEV catalog.

Technical ContextAI

CWE-427 (Uncontrolled Search Path Element) is the root cause: the AMD Ryzen Master installer or an associated privileged process resolves DLL dependencies by searching directories in a predictable order, at least one of which is writable by low-privileged users. By pre-staging a malicious DLL with the expected filename in such a directory, an attacker causes the privileged process to load and execute attacker-controlled code instead of the legitimate library. AMD Ryzen Master is a Windows-only utility providing CPU overclocking, voltage tuning, and performance monitoring for AMD Ryzen processors. The CVSS 4.0 vector AV:L/AC:L/AT:N/PR:L/UI:P confirms the attack surface is local, complexity is low once in position, no special attack prerequisites are required beyond standard user credentials, and a passive user interaction event - such as triggering or waiting for an installation - is necessary.

RemediationAI

Update AMD Ryzen Master to the patched releases specified in AMD Security Bulletin AMD-SB-9020 (https://www.amd.com/en/resources/product-security/bulletin/AMD-SB-9020.html): Ryzen Master to version 3.0.0.4199, Ryzen Master SDK to version 3.0.1.4732, and the Ryzen 3000 Series legacy variant to version 2.14.3.5040. Where immediate patching is not possible, restrict write permissions on user-writable directories present in the DLL search path - particularly the application installation directory and any directories listed in the system or user PATH environment variable - so that standard user accounts cannot pre-stage files there; note this may break other applications that legitimately depend on user-writable path entries. Additionally, configure endpoint security tooling to alert on unsigned or unexpected DLLs loaded by AMD Ryzen Master processes during installation events, and avoid running Ryzen Master installations on systems with untrusted local users or known malware presence.
